WebRelational Indexing : An indexing system developed by J E L Farradane, which involves the identification of the relationship between each pair of terms of a given subject statement and representation of those relations by relational operators. Relational Operators : Special symbols used to link the isolates in Relational Indexing to create analets. Webindexed.
